Understanding Adaptive Soundtracks

Adaptive soundtracks are music scores that change in real-time based on gameplay variables. These changes can include shifts in tempo, volume, instrumentation, or even genre. When players experience tense moments, the soundtrack might intensify, whereas during calm periods, it might become more subdued. This responsiveness creates a more immersive environment, making players feel more connected to the game world.

Responding to Player Health and Status

One of the most common uses of adaptive soundtracks involves reacting to the player’s health. For example, when a player’s health drops below a critical threshold, the music might become more frantic or ominous, signaling danger. Conversely, when health is restored, the soundtrack can shift back to a more peaceful theme. Similarly, other status indicators like stamina, mana, or special buffs can influence musical changes, enriching the gameplay experience.

Techniques for Implementation

  • Layered Music: Use multiple musical layers that can be added or removed depending on player status.
  • Real-time Audio Processing: Implement audio middleware tools like FMOD or Wwise to control sound parameters dynamically.
  • Event Triggers: Set up game events that trigger specific musical cues when health or status changes occur.

Design Tips for Effective Adaptive Soundtracks

To create compelling adaptive soundtracks, consider these design principles:

  • Maintain Musical Cohesion: Ensure transitions between different musical states are smooth to avoid jarring experiences.
  • Use Subtle Cues: Sometimes, less is more. Small changes can effectively communicate status without overwhelming the player.
  • Test Extensively: Playtest with various scenarios to ensure the soundtrack responds appropriately across different game situations.
